Our Primary School is a vibrant, lively academy for children aged between 2 and 11. We’re proud to offer a high standard of education to our pupils – a number that’s rising every year. The children are divided into mixed ability classes. They enjoy outstanding facilities in two main buildings, each of which has its own central hall/ gymnasium, sports fields, safety surface playgrounds, ICT wireless and laptops/tablets and shared art areas. Pupils also benefit from the Academy’s unique location, at the heart of a magnificent, unspoilt valley – the ideal spot for nature studies.

 

Parents and carers are much involved at our Primary School. In fact, thanks to a flourishing Parents and Teachers Association, we have many new additional facilities. We welcome parents’ interest in School activities – for us, they are part of Academy and community life.

 

We’ve worked hard to develop our responsibility posts within the Primary School, and have created a structured and expanding curriculum. Our staff work closely together and co-ordinate their plans to ensure there’s continuity in this curriculum between Infant and Junior age ranges.
